Leadership Roles and Responsibilities


Are your labor-management leaders ready to meet the challenge?
 

Translating an agreement from words to action takes leadership that understands their roles and responsibilities.
 
FMCS mediators have designed a program focused on preparing labor and management leaders how best to assume the roles and take on the responsibilities that a collective bargaining agreement has given them.

A wide range of skills and best-practice knowledge is presented in this program, which can also be customized to meet the specific needs of an organization.
